ABSTRACT
The potential threat of heavy metals from solid wastes dumpsites in urban cities to our
environment and human heath has led to many studies to fine out the level of its risk to human
health. In this study, determination of heavy metals content in soil fromsolid waste dumpsites in
Kaduna metropolis of Kaduna state, Nigeria was carried out using Contamination Factor
index.Soilsamples were collected from three selected dumpsites in Kaduna metropolis
respectively. Control samples were obtained at about 200m away from the dumpsites, using
standard sampling methods. Soil extracts was analyzed using, Atomic Absorption
Spectrophotometric (AAS) method and subjected to statistical analysis. The results showed that;
Heavy metals (Fe, Zn, Cu, Mn, Cr, Ni, Cd and Pb) mean- concentration (mg/kg) from the solid
waste dumpsites were; 2,387.7, 1,123.0, 362.0, 956.1, 161.8, 44.9, 16.0 & 242.4 respectively.
While, the concentrations obtained from the control site for; Fe, Zn, Cu, Mn, Cr, Ni, Cd &Pb
were; 5,167.8, 520.0, 80.1, 267. 0, 105.3, 12.8, BDL & 107.4 respectively. The trend of heavy
metals contamination status from the solid waste dumpsites, were; Cu>Ni>Pb> Zn >Mn> Cr>
Fe, ANOVA at P> 0.05 showed that, there was no significant difference in the concentrations of
Zn, Mn, Cr, Ni& Cd, while, the concentrations of Fe, u&Pb_ were significantly different. The
